Granja Nomada Espadin Mezcal NOM 1120 The wine's bright acidity andGranaja Nomada Espadin is an authentic, artesanal mezcal produced by mezcalero Hugo Quinto in San Dionisio Ocotepec, Oaxaca, using 8 year old Agave Espadn. It is traditionally cooked in earthen pits for 6 days, crushed with a tahona, and double distilled in copper, offering a flavor profile of fresh agave, smoke, and citrus.
